AFI Latin American Film Festival
When: September 28
Where: AFI Silver Theatre and Cultural Center at 8633 Colesville Road, Silver Spring, MD 20910
What: This year's selection of 50 films makes it the biggest festival yet! Highlights of the festival include the Opening Night selection, the rousing LA-set hip hop drama FILLY BROWN; Mexico's A SECRET WORLD, a sensation at the Berlin International Film Festival; the US premiere of Argentina's CLANDESTINE CHILDHOOD; David Riker's Mexico-US immigration drama, THE GIRL, starring Abbie Cornish; festival sensation UNA NOCHE, from Cuba; TROPICÁLIA, the definitive documentary on the influential Brazilian music movement, and LA CASA DEL RITMO, A FILM ABOUT LOS AMIGOS INVISIBLES, chronicling the story of Venezuela's most famous Grammy-winning band; HERE AND THERE, winner of the top prize in Critic's Week at this year's Cannes Film Festival; and Alex de la Iglesia's lunatic media satire, AS LUCK WOULD HAVE IT, starring Mexico's Salma Hayek.

Bengal Tiger at the Baghdad Zoo
When: September 28 – October 1
Where: Roundhouse Theatre at 8641 Colesville Road, Silver Spring, MD 20910
What: This ferocious, groundbreaking new comedy follows the intertwined lives of a quick-witted tiger, two homesick American marines, and a troubled Iraqi gardener as they roam the streets of war-torn Baghdad in search of meaning, redemption, and a toilet seat made of gold.
